Filipina Gymnast Jessica Rayne Bags 3 Silver Medals in USA Tourney

Young Filipina Gymnast Bags 3 Silvers in USA Tourney

A 15-year-old Filipina gymnast bags three silver medals, bringing honor to the country from Los Angeles, California, USA.

Jessica Rayne Tijam the Filipina Rhythmic Gymnast who dominated 2020 Rhythmic LA Gymnastics Invitationals held last February 2 in Sylmar, Los Angeles, California, bagging three silver medals on the said tournament.

According to Philippine Athletes at Multi-Sport Event, The 15-year old gymnast, who represented Emerald City Academy of Rhythmic Gymnastics in the nearby San Diego, made a silver medal haul in the Hoop, Ball, and Ribbon apparatus, registering a score of 19.100, 19.800 and 15.400, respectively. She was placed 4th in the Club event, scoring 16.300.

Jessica tallied an overall total score of 70.600, placing her second out of nine competitors in the FIG Level 10 Senior category.

A year ago, Jessica also bannered the national delegation. She represented the country along with the 13-year-old gymnastic prodigy Breanna Labadan in the FIG Junior World Championship in Moscow, Russia.

Unfortunately, they did not advance in the finals of their respective categories but Tijam won a bronze medal in the ribbon category of the Koop Cup in Toronto, Canada.
